The German army also captured a large number of soldiers from the Royal Yugoslav Army in April german hot women 1941. Many of the prisoners were quickly released, but Serbs were kept in German captivity, and small contingents of them were deployed in various parts of the Reich. Serbia had a collaborating government, but Germany did not recognize the Geneva Convention in its dealings with this government . There were numerous trials against Serbian prisoners involved with German women. Although a study of this topic remains to be done, it appears that the courts martial treated Serbian POWs in similar ways to the western POWs.

Bertha Benz, a German lady from Pforzheim, was Karl’s colleague. She supported the assembling of his most memorable horseless carriage with her endowment. In 1888, she took her two children and drove the Patent Motorwagen Model III 120 miles from Mannheim to Pforzheim without telling her better half. This was whenever somebody first drove an auto over a significant distance, fixing all innovative entanglements on the way.
